Rich Heritage of Winemaking in New Zealand
At Church Road Cellar Door, you can witness the evolution of winemaking in New Zealand, where it all began.
Founded in 1897, Church Road Winery is one of the oldest wineries in the country and has played a pivotal role in establishing and popularizing Bordeaux-style red wines globally. The winery's legacy is closely tied to Tom McDonald, a visionary winemaker whose contributions have left a lasting impact.
